CINEVISTA 210 is a motion picture film emulation PowerGrade and LUT pack designed to emulate the nostalgic look and feel of 16mm and 35mm film. More than just presets, it’s a toolkit that brings subtle analog qualities back into your footage, such as soft halation, organic grain, and vintage lens characteristics.

The look of CINEVISTA 210 was inspired by slice-of-life cinema that treasures small, intimate moments and finds beauty in them. Films like these often carry a sense of nostalgia, warmth, and memory. If you’re looking for LUTs and PowerGrades that deliver the “film look” with a professional workflow, this pack was built for you.

PowerGrades are plug-and-play tools for DaVinci Resolve. They’re prebuilt color grading templates that instantly apply a cinematic look to your footage. But unlike LUTs, PowerGrades give you complete control over every adjustment, like shadows, highlights, contrast, and more. You can even fine-tune every detail to make it your own. With CINEVISTA 210, achieving nostalgic film color becomes both easy and endlessly customizable.

CineVista 210 — a repeatable cinematic grade for client and portfolio work

The gist: If you're building a freelance video or content-creation side hustle, CineVista 210 gives DaVinci Resolve editors a consistent film-emulation look they can drop onto client deliverables without hand-grading every project from scratch.

  • Fits two workflows: ships as ready-to-apply LUTs for fast turnaround and fully adjustable PowerGrades for editors who need client-specific control over shadows, highlights, and contrast.
  • Film-texture finish: bakes in soft halation, organic grain, and vintage lens rendering, which reads in a demo reel as a deliberate creative choice rather than a stock preset.
  • A signature look: the warm, nostalgic "slice-of-life" tone gives freelancers a repeatable grade they can apply across multiple client projects for a recognizable style.
  • Built for DaVinci Resolve: PowerGrades load directly into Resolve's color page, so there's no extra plugin or workflow change for editors already cutting in that NLE.

Moment credits the CineVista line to filmmaker Mason Charles, who built it to channel the textured, handled look of 35mm film into digital footage — the creator behind this pack.

Best for: freelance editors and creators who want one standardized cinematic look across client work. Skip it if: you edit primarily in Premiere or Final Cut and need the PowerGrade-level control — those are Resolve-only, though the LUTs alone work in any NLE.
